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

2 Stron V   1 2 >  
Reply to this topicStart new topic
> Instalacja PHP na komputrze w środowisku WINDOWS (xp)
aduko
post 11.09.2003, 21:12:53
Post #1





Grupa: Zarejestrowani
Postów: 9
Pomógł: 0
Dołączył: 11.09.2003
Skąd: Nowy Sącz

Ostrzeżenie: (0%)
-----


Mam problem z instalacją php. Postępowałem wedługł instrukcj instalacji, i niedziała, zainstalowałme Apache (działa) zainstalowałem MySQL (działa) no ale php już nie angrysmiley.gif . Prosze o szybką i rzetelną pomoc!!! :!: rolleyes.gif :?: :!: :!: :?: :?:
Go to the top of the page
+Quote Post
qbba
post 11.09.2003, 21:57:26
Post #2





Grupa: Zarejestrowani
Postów: 78
Pomógł: 0
Dołączył: 25.10.2002
Skąd: z kabla:)/ czewa

Ostrzeżenie: (10%)
X----


kupilem samochód, wlałem paliwo, nie jedzie.

Opisz to dokaldniej albo jeszcze lepiej poczytaj w manualu jeszcze raz o instalce.
Go to the top of the page
+Quote Post
Omega
post 11.09.2003, 21:58:22
Post #3





Grupa: Zarejestrowani
Postów: 273
Pomógł: 0
Dołączył: 5.05.2003
Skąd: Mazury

Ostrzeżenie: (0%)
-----


Ja bym proponował na początek zainstalować jakis gotowy serwer, np. Krasnal, albo FoxServ.

A co do tego ze nie działa, to najprawdopodobniej masz błąd w ścieżkach w php.ini (ale tylko gdybam) 8)


--------------------
<<< EB >>>
Go to the top of the page
+Quote Post
intol
post 12.09.2003, 09:37:23
Post #4





Grupa: Zarejestrowani
Postów: 110
Pomógł: 1
Dołączył: 29.07.2003

Ostrzeżenie: (10%)
X----


Stary - to nie takie hop - siup :!: Tu trzeba pokonfigurowć lub właśnie np. PHPTraid lub FoxServer instalnąć (choć nie polecam - lepiej samemu)


--------------------
Zbiór najlepszych technologicznych artykułów (programowanie, internet, linux)
Go to the top of the page
+Quote Post
scanner
post 12.09.2003, 13:29:51
Post #5





Grupa: Zarząd
Postów: 3 503
Pomógł: 28
Dołączył: 17.10.2002
Skąd: Wrocław




Dlaczego nikt z Was nie zasugerował autorowi posta aby przejrzał logi Apache'a?
Znajdują się one w katalogu %APACHE_DIR%/logs
Polecam takrze przejrzenie "Dziennika zdarzeń" systemu - sekcja "Aplikacje".

To pomaga rozwiązac większość problemów.
Prawdopodobnie nie skopiowałeś któregoś z plików php do odpowiedniego katalogu. Wróce do domu (za jakąś godzinę) to pokarzę Ci, co ja robię, aby uruchomić mojego localhosta.

Omega: odkąd samodzielnie zainstalowałem to co mam w sygnaturce, nikomu nie będę polecał gotowych pakietów.
intol: cała zabawa zajmuje może z 20 minut
qbba: może aduko nie wie gdzie szukac logów itp?


--------------------
scanner.info
Warto pamiętać: KISS, DRY
Go to the top of the page
+Quote Post
scanner
post 13.09.2003, 10:25:14
Post #6





Grupa: Zarząd
Postów: 3 503
Pomógł: 28
Dołączył: 17.10.2002
Skąd: Wrocław




Ok. Oto moj przepis jak stworzyć sobie przyjemne środowisko pracy.
1. Stwórz katalog D:WebServer
2. Zainstaluj w nim Apache (2.0.47)
3. Zainstaluj w nim MySQL (4.0.14b)
4. Utwórz katalog D:WebServerphp5
5. Rozpakuj do niego PHP5 ( http://snaps.php.net - Latest CVS 5.0.x-dev )
6. Edytuj %APACHE_DIR%/conf/httpd.conf:
Cytat
  a. LoadModule php5_module %PHP5_DIR%/sapi/php4apache2.dll  
  b. DocumentRoot "D:DokumentyMy Webs"
  c. #
     # This should be changed to whatever you set DocumentRoot to.
     #
     <Directory "D:DokumentyMy Webs">
  d. DirectoryIndex index.html index.html.var index.php
  e. AddType application/x-httpd-php .php

7. Skopiuj
Cytat
  a. %PHP5_DIR%/php.ini-recomended -> %WIN_DIR%/php.ini
  b. %PHP5_DIR%/php4ts.dll -> %APACHE%/bin  
  c. %PHP5_DIR%/dlls/iconv.dll -> %APACHE%/bin  
  d. %PHP5_DIR%/dlls/libmysql.dll -> %APACHE%/bin

8. Edytuj: %WIN_DIR%/php.ini
Cytat
  a. error_reporting  =  E_ALL
  b. log_errors = Off
  c. display_errors = On
  d. extension_dir = "D:/WebServer/php5/extensions/"
  e. extension=php_mysql.dll

I wszystko mi działa. A jeśli nie, to wszystko pisze w logach Apache'a - najczęściej zdarza się jakaś literówka w php.ini lub httpd.conf.

Uwaga:.


--------------------
scanner.info
Warto pamiętać: KISS, DRY
Go to the top of the page
+Quote Post
aduko
post 14.09.2003, 17:58:15
Post #7





Grupa: Zarejestrowani
Postów: 9
Pomógł: 0
Dołączył: 11.09.2003
Skąd: Nowy Sącz

Ostrzeżenie: (0%)
-----


Scanner napisał
Cytat
3. Zainstaluj w nim MySQL (4.0.14b)  


A może być wersja 4.0.15, raczej nic sie niezmienia?
Go to the top of the page
+Quote Post
scanner
post 14.09.2003, 18:11:08
Post #8





Grupa: Zarząd
Postów: 3 503
Pomógł: 28
Dołączył: 17.10.2002
Skąd: Wrocław




W nawiasach podałem wersje, które miałem w momencie pisania posta.


--------------------
scanner.info
Warto pamiętać: KISS, DRY
Go to the top of the page
+Quote Post
aduko
post 14.09.2003, 18:22:30
Post #9





Grupa: Zarejestrowani
Postów: 9
Pomógł: 0
Dołączył: 11.09.2003
Skąd: Nowy Sącz

Ostrzeżenie: (0%)
-----


Gdzie można ściągnąć Apache2 ? Ściągam przez eMule ale zawolno...
Go to the top of the page
+Quote Post
scanner
post 14.09.2003, 18:28:05
Post #10





Grupa: Zarząd
Postów: 3 503
Pomógł: 28
Dołączył: 17.10.2002
Skąd: Wrocław




Aż cos brzydkiego mi sie ciśnie na usta...

http://httpd.apache.org/ !!!!!!


--------------------
scanner.info
Warto pamiętać: KISS, DRY
Go to the top of the page
+Quote Post
aduko
post 14.09.2003, 18:59:28
Post #11





Grupa: Zarejestrowani
Postów: 9
Pomógł: 0
Dołączył: 11.09.2003
Skąd: Nowy Sącz

Ostrzeżenie: (0%)
-----


Czy mam wszystko w jednym katalogu instalować? Tzn. php w katalogu *:/WebServer/php,ale Apache i MySQL w WebServer :?: :?:
Go to the top of the page
+Quote Post
scanner
post 14.09.2003, 19:34:56
Post #12





Grupa: Zarząd
Postów: 3 503
Pomógł: 28
Dołączył: 17.10.2002
Skąd: Wrocław




angrysmiley.gif
Cytat
D:WebServerApache2 (Apache)
D:WebServerMySQL4 (MySQL)
D:WebServerphp5 (php5)
D:DokumentyMy Webs (katalogi z projektami)
D:DokumentyMy Webs_addons (dodatki)
D:DokumentyMy Webs_addonssmarty
D:DokumentyMy Webs_addonsadodb
D:DokumentyMy Webs_pma (phpMyAdmin)


--------------------
scanner.info
Warto pamiętać: KISS, DRY
Go to the top of the page
+Quote Post
aduko
post 14.09.2003, 20:23:17
Post #13





Grupa: Zarejestrowani
Postów: 9
Pomógł: 0
Dołączył: 11.09.2003
Skąd: Nowy Sącz

Ostrzeżenie: (0%)
-----


dobra, działa, ale mi kodu nieprzetwarza sad.gif zamiast tego co jest w kodzie zapisane, to mi nagi kod wyskakuje sad.gif co jest :?: ](*,)
Go to the top of the page
+Quote Post
bendi
post 15.09.2003, 15:39:05
Post #14





Grupa: Zarejestrowani
Postów: 401
Pomógł: 5
Dołączył: 14.09.2003
Skąd: Wrocław

Ostrzeżenie: (0%)
-----


Cytat
dobra, działa, ale mi kodu nieprzetwarza sad.gif zamiast tego co jest w kodzie zapisane, to mi nagi kod wyskakuje  :(  co jest :?:  ](*,)


Poszukalbys zamiast ludzi denerwowac !!

Ale skoro juz jestes taki natretny to masz

http://www.semestr.pl/~bendi/apache2_php4.exe

Jest to instalka php 4.3 i apacha 2 (testowane na XP), narazie powinno Ci starczyc.

Po instalacj wejdz do katalogu C:Apache2 i znajdz plik usluga_systemowa.txt (albo cos takiego) zrob co jest napisane, ponownie uruchom kompa i kliknij ten link http://localhost/test.php - jezeli widzsiz napis to wszystko gra i swoje pliki mozez wrzucac do katalogu
C:Apache2htdocs

No chyba ze Ci sie nie chce nic na nowo instalowac, to sproboj zmienic tagi <? ?> na <?php ?> moze to jest problem.

Powodzenia 8)


--------------------
Go to the top of the page
+Quote Post
aduko
post 15.09.2003, 21:54:18
Post #15





Grupa: Zarejestrowani
Postów: 9
Pomógł: 0
Dołączył: 11.09.2003
Skąd: Nowy Sącz

Ostrzeżenie: (0%)
-----


biggrin.gif Sory za problem :wink: Wszystko mi działa... ale według innej instrukcji. Książka
Cytat
php i MySQL: programowanie sieci WEB


Dzięki za wszystkie wskazówki i przepraszam za zamieszanie :mrgreen:
Go to the top of the page
+Quote Post
JOHNY
post 18.09.2003, 12:55:33
Post #16





Grupa: Zarejestrowani
Postów: 297
Pomógł: 0
Dołączył: 17.01.2003
Skąd: Tarnów

Ostrzeżenie: (0%)
-----


Czy jest duża różnica między apache 1.3.27 a 2 questionmark.gif bo zastanawiam sie nad postawieniem 2
Argumenty za i przeciw mile widziane smile.gif
Go to the top of the page
+Quote Post
bendi
post 18.09.2003, 15:54:11
Post #17





Grupa: Zarejestrowani
Postów: 401
Pomógł: 5
Dołączył: 14.09.2003
Skąd: Wrocław

Ostrzeżenie: (0%)
-----


Cytat
Czy jest duża różnica między apache 1.3.27 a 2 ?


A moze bys najpierw poszukal (nawet na tym forum angrysmiley.gif ) to nie takie trudne

http://forum.php.pl/viewtopic.php?t=5055

A jezeli szukales i potrzebujesz innych informacji to sprecyzuj pytanie.


--------------------
Go to the top of the page
+Quote Post
rura
post 19.09.2003, 00:55:13
Post #18





Grupa: Zarejestrowani
Postów: 5
Pomógł: 0
Dołączył: 19.09.2003
Skąd: Sadyba

Ostrzeżenie: (0%)
-----


Witam wszystkich !
Czy próbował może ktos takiej kombinacji ?
Przeszedłem już przez fazę Apacza i PHP5, ale pozostaje kłopt z MySQL-em.(Tak podejrzewam). Kiedy włączam phpmyadmin pokazuje sie coś takiego
Kod
nie można załadować modułu MySQL,

proszę sprawdzić konfigurację php
. Normalnie kiedy chodzi Apacz 2.0.47 + php 4.3.3 wszystko jest w porzadku.
Czy ktoś mógłby powiedzieć co z tym fantem trzeba zrobić?
Może zamienić MySQL na 4 ?
Dzieki za jakieś info


--------------------
rUrA
Go to the top of the page
+Quote Post
scanner
post 19.09.2003, 10:02:01
Post #19





Grupa: Zarząd
Postów: 3 503
Pomógł: 28
Dołączył: 17.10.2002
Skąd: Wrocław




No przecież kilka postów wyżej (na pierwszej stronie tego wątku) dałem działające rozwiazanie. Co prawda z MySQL 4 ale tym lepiej smile.gif


--------------------
scanner.info
Warto pamiętać: KISS, DRY
Go to the top of the page
+Quote Post
rura
post 19.09.2003, 18:11:50
Post #20





Grupa: Zarejestrowani
Postów: 5
Pomógł: 0
Dołączył: 19.09.2003
Skąd: Sadyba

Ostrzeżenie: (0%)
-----


A sorki, ale widzę , że nie wyświetliło tematu mojego postu. Apacz jest w wersji1.3.28.
Może rzeczywiście zdecyduje się na mysql v. 4.
ale teraz sprawdze co się stanie po dopisaniu
Cytat
extension=php_mysql.dll
. A w katalogu php5/extensions nie ma pliku php_mysql.dll . Spróbuje z php_msql.dll .
Cytat
php Warning: Unknown(): Unable to load dynamic library 'f:/serwer/php5/extensio
ns/php_msql.dll' - Nie mo┐na odnalečŠ okreťlonego modu│u.
in Unknown on line 0
Apache/1.3.28 (Win32) php/5.0.0b1 running...
Teraz php_mssql.dll - to samo. Coś tu pisze , że nie znaleziono pliku ntwdblib.dll.
I to samo, myphpadmin wyświetla
Cytat
nie można załadować modułu MySQL,
proszę sprawdzić konfigurację php.

Mam nadzieję, że z Apaczem2 PHP5 zadziała.


--------------------
rUrA
Go to the top of the page
+Quote Post

2 Stron V   1 2 >
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 19.07.2025 - 09:39